The place
The Whole Bowl's Hawthorne location is a small walk-up counter at 4526 SE Hawthorne Blvd in the Hawthorne District, one of 13 Portland-metro locations of a single-dish chain Tali Ovadia started as a food cart in 2001. Ryan Carpenter of the smoothie chain Moberi bought the company in January 2025 and kept the menu unchanged (Willamette Week, Jan 6 2025). Open daily 11am to 9pm.
The gluten-free setup
The entire menu is one dish, and the official site describes it as nut, gluten, wheat, hydrogenated oil and guilt free. FindMeGlutenFree lists the Hawthorne location as reported dedicated gluten-free. There is no GFCO or GFFP certification on file, so treat this as a strong first-party claim rather than a lab-certified one.
What to order
There is only one dish: brown rice, black and red beans, avocado, cilantro, black olives, Tillamook cheddar, sour cream, salsa and the signature lemon-garlic Tali Sauce, named for founder Tali Ovadia. Ask for it vegan to swap out the cheese and sour cream.
The move
Order at the counter. There is no menu to parse, so most orders are out in a few minutes. Confirm hours before a special trip since Moberi's 2025 ownership change has come with new Whole Bowl locations opening around Portland.
